Accessibility at events

Indiana University departments and units are ultimately responsible for the accessibility of the events they host or sponsor. They should take steps in order to ensure fair and equal access to university services, facilities, and functions. Specific steps necessary may include:

  • Include an accommodation statement in publications inviting participation in University-sponsored events. Publicity for events should notify potential attendees how to request information or request accommodations. Advance notice may be requested as some accommodations may require time for the university to arrange.
  • Arrange for live (CART) captioning for an event.
  • Arrange for ASL interpreters for an event.
  • Assign responsibility to an individual to monitor planning for and managing during the event for adherence to ADA requirements. Train staff to respond to any request for accommodation, and assign staff to be responsible for this issue.
  • Identify parking areas, curb cuts and entrances, accessible water fountains, and restrooms for persons with disabilities.
  • If food or beverages are served, review food service provided to include services for persons with disabilities.
